Technical Specifications

INCI Name: Lauryl Glucoside
CAS Number: 110615-47-9
EINECS Number: 400-750-6
Active Content: 50-53%
Physical State: Clear to slightly hazy liquid
pH (10% solution): 11.5-12.5
Color (Gardner): ≤ 3
Viscosity (25°C): 100-250 cP
CMC: 0.15 mM (25°C)
Surface Tension: 28.5 mN/m (0.1% solution)
HLB Value: 13.1
Foam Height: 130-150 mm (Ross Miles test)
Biodegradability: Readily biodegradable (>90%)
Solubility: Water soluble
Packaging Options: 200kg drums, 1000kg IBC
